Full description

Department of Environment, 1973, Northam, 14 (List of Blds of Arch or Historic Interest). SDV336688.

Vicarage, Fore Street. Late Georgian plain 2 storey large house standing at back of garden. Eaves cornice, returned round quoin pilasters. Firstst floor band. Sash windows with glazing bars. Central projection, east, has ground floor French casements. Slate roof, hipped.
